> I have create a DB replication with 2 masters and the CS setup is up with the same.Now when the M1 is up and the CS operations are running normally and if the M2 goes down there is no chance to know that the M2 is gone.There are no notifications either in the UI nor in the MS logs.
> Note:Even when the M1 goes down there is a notification only in the logs and no notification in the UI . It would be good to have an alert in the UI as watching logs all the time may not be possible.
